std::pmr::new_delete_resource(3) C++ Standard Libary std::pmr::new_delete_resource(3)

std::pmr::new_delete_resource - std::pmr::new_delete_resource


Defined in header <memory_resource>
std::pmr::memory_resource* new_delete_resource() noexcept; (since C++17)


Returns a pointer to a memory_resource that uses the global operator new and
operator delete to allocate memory.


Returns a pointer p to a static storage duration object of a type derived from
std::pmr::memory_resource, with the following properties:


* its allocate() function uses ::operator new to allocate memory;
* its deallocate() function uses ::operator delete to deallocate memory;
* for any memory_resource r, p->is_equal(r) returns &r == p.


The same value is returned every time this function is called.
